The National Monuments Service's description
Situated across the crest of rising ground on a broad promontory at the S side of Lough Macnean Upper is a field system and a complex of earthworks, ringforts, hut sites and cashels. The extant system is visible as orthogonal elements comprising a long linear field boundary running N-S, up to and around the W end of CV001-007---- a ringfort, with another long linear boundary running WNW to ESE, roughly perpendicular to the former element but clearly running across an earlier enclosure (CV001-031----) Additional elements of curving and straight field boundaries with annexes can be discerned to the E and SE with faint traces to the south of CV001-009---- a ringfort - cashel.
